Bring out the Wonder in Wood, Naturally

As North America continues its long tradition of using wood to build homes, and interior features, Ceridust 1060 Vita is a bio-based wax additive for furniture, flooring, window frames and beams. It is based on renewable, non-food competing feedstock and delivers the smooth non-slip, soft-touch and high scratch resistance expected from a high-quality protective finish. Formulators also benefit from its easy dispersion. It can also be used for powder coatings to combine the warmth of wood with modern design trends such as bright and bold colors.

In addition to carrying the Vita designation, Ceridust 1060 Vita is certified by the prestigious EcoTain label for products that have undergone a screening process using 36 social, environmental and economic criteria, exceeding sustainability market standards and offering best-in-class performance. Superior Architectural Solutions

From colors in the home to bold façade paints that brighten up cityscapes, Dispersogen PLF 100 is an innovative low-foaming dispersing agent that helps ensure the color “wow” factor. It’s another Clariant sustainable solution that holds our Ecotain label, being low VOC (< 1% in ISO 11890-2), free of organic solvents and suitable for eco-labels. It’s also high performance, helping to improve efficiency for paste producers, even when using hard-to-disperse red pigment concentrates, meaning no snail trails on colored paints or time or expense needed for repeat coats to cover them up.

A new offering in architectural and industrial coatings is the Hostaperm Yellow H3G 02, a “Next Generation Pigment” Yellow 154. With a lower cost of use due to an increased efficiency in the production process, it provides a higher color strength in both waterborne and solvent borne coatings than current grades on the market. In addition, and to meet the trends toward sustainability, Hostaperm Yellow H3G 02 can be co-dispersed with inorganic pigments in waterborne coatings with a dissolver only, another example of Clariant’s commitment to more sustainable solutions.
